Alexander lands in asia minor in the spring of three, three four b c. And not long after he reaches asia minor, he crosses over the hellespont. Alexander this battle at the river, he defeats the persians and the greek mercenaries serving in the persian army. At this battle he wins a decisive victory. Then continues further south. He captures important cities such as sardis, miletus and helicarnassus. He then heads inland, into inland asia minor. He famously slashes through the gordian knot, according to one tradition.
